The word or phrase griffon refers to large vulture of southern Europe and northern Africa having pale plumage with black wings, or breed of medium-sized long-headed dogs with downy undercoat and harsh wiry outer coat; originated in Holland but largely developed in France, or breed of various very small compact wiry-coated dogs of Belgian origin having a short bearded muzzle, or winged monster with the head of an eagle and the body of a lion.
